Insight into our work LIV Leben in Vielfalt offers people with disabilities a home and a community that is tailored to their individual needs. We specialize in accompanying adults with complex cognitive impairments - often in connection with an autism spectrum disorder (ASD). Our supported residential groups and daily structure offers are distributed across various quarters in Basel. LIV is part of the cantonal administration of Basel-Stadt and an institution of the Office for Social Contributions in the Department for Economy, Social Affairs and Environment.
